Spotlight on Otto and Adya van Rees, leading artists of the European avant-garde in the 20th century
On the occasion of the first French retrospective devoted to Otto van Rees (1884–1957) and Adya van Rees-Dutilh (1876–1959), the Musée de Montmartre is presenting around a hundred works -paintings, graphic art, embroidery, sculptures- retracing their artistic, romantic and family lives. The exhibition highlights their avant-garde contribution to modern art. Open to the public from 20 March 2026.
